ANDREWS, Presiding Judge.

Willie and Calandra Lewis, father and daughter, appeal from the trial court's grant of summary judgment to State Farm Mutual Automobile Insurance Company on their claim for medical expenses after Calandra was injured in a car accident. For the reasons which follow, we affirm.

The facts in this case are not in dispute. Calandra Lewis was injured in an automobile accident while driving a Honda Civic owned by her father Willie Lewis...
